| * Test having two processes attempt to set the clock at the same time. |
| * Ensure that both actually set the clock, and it is the later one that |
| * takes effect. [Note: It would be hard to test that they both set |
| * the clock without setting up atomic operations. Will just test that |
| * at least one set took place.] |
| * The two processes will attempt to set the clock to TESTTIME+DELTA |
| * and TESTTIME-DELTA. |
| * |
| * The clock_id chosen for this test is CLOCK_REALTIME. |
| * The date chosen is Nov 12, 2002 ~11:13am. |
| */ |
| #include <stdio.h> |
| #include <time.h> |
| #include <stdlib.h> |
| #include <sys/types.h> |
| #include <unistd.h> |
| #include "posixtest.h" |
| |
| #define TESTTIME 1037128358 |
| #define DELTA 5 |
| #define ACCEPTABLEDELTA 1 |
| #define LONGTIME 3 //== long enough for both clocks to be set |
| |
| int main(int argc, char *argv[]) |
| { |
| struct timespec tpget, tsreset; |
| int pid, delta; |
| |
| if (clock_gettime(CLOCK_REALTIME, &tsreset) != 0) { |
| perror("clock_getime() did not return success\n"); |
| return PTS_UNRESOLVED; |
| } |
| |
| if ((pid = fork()) == 0) { |
| /*child*/ |
| struct timespec tschild; |
| |
| tschild.tv_sec = TESTTIME+DELTA; |
| tschild.tv_nsec = 0; |
| if (clock_settime(CLOCK_REALTIME, &tschild) != 0) { |
| printf("Note: clock_settime() failed\n"); |
| } |
| if (clock_gettime(CLOCK_REALTIME, &tpget) == -1) { |
| printf("Note: Error in clock_gettime()\n"); |
| } |
| |
| } else { |
| /*parent*/ |
| struct timespec tsparent; |
| int pass = 0; |
| |
| tsparent.tv_sec = TESTTIME-DELTA; |
| tsparent.tv_nsec = 0; |
| if (clock_settime(CLOCK_REALTIME, &tsparent) != 0) { |
| printf("Note: clock_settime() failed\n"); |
| } |
| |
| sleep(LONGTIME); |
| |
| /* |
| * Ensure we set clock to TESTTIME-DELTA or TESTTIME+DELTA. |
| * Assume that clock increased monotonically and clock_gettime, |
| * clock_settime return correct values. |
| */ |
| |
| if (clock_gettime(CLOCK_REALTIME, &tpget) == -1) { |
| printf("Note: Error in clock_gettime()\n"); |
| } |
| |
| delta = (tpget.tv_sec-LONGTIME) - TESTTIME; |
| |
| if ((delta <= ACCEPTABLEDELTA-DELTA) || |
| (delta <= ACCEPTABLEDELTA+DELTA)) { |
| pass = 1; |
| } |
| |
| if (clock_settime(CLOCK_REALTIME, &tsreset) != 0) { |
| printf("Need to manually reset time\n"); |
| } |
| |
| if (pass) { |
| printf("Test PASSED\n"); |
| return PTS_PASS; |
| } else { |
| printf("Test FAILED\n"); |
| return PTS_FAIL; |
| } |
| } |
| return PTS_UNRESOLVED; |
| } |
